Popis: The purpose of this article is to describe the process used to create the Mental Health Innovation (MHI), a multicomponent implementation strategy that integrates evidence-based mental health interventions into the Nurse-Family Partnership (NFP), a national home visiting program delivered by nurses to low-income mothers.The Exploration, Preparation, Implementation, Sustainment (EPIS) framework outlines the multistep, stakeholder-engaged process used to develop the MHI.Engaging stakeholders provided an in-depth understanding of NFP infrastructure and the needs of NFP nurses and their clients. This understanding was key to designing a multicomponent implementation strategy to integrate mental health interventions within national and local NFP infrastructure and existing care processes.Application of implementation frameworks such as EPIS provides a guide to integrating evidence-based interventions in a systematic, intentional, and rigorous manner, which in turn may promote their wide scale use and long-term sustainability.
